>Also from the Toronto Sun

>EARL OF WISDOM: Ex-Raptors centre Acie Earl has made a
>name for himself in Australia's National Basketball
>League. Earl, who played this season with the Sydney
>Kings, was named to the league all-star team after
>averaging 21.6 points (fifth in the league), 12.5
>rebounds (third) and 2.9 blocks (second). On the
>down side, Earl ranked third in the league with 3.9
>turnovers per game.
